The Queenstown Planning Commission met Feb. 7, 2018, welcomed new members Loretta Hohmann and Perry Stutman, and distributed the Commission bylaws. Tom Davis of DMS Associates presented a final site plan for 306 Del Rhodes Avenue and requested relief from the 10-foot setback; the Town Planner indicated the applicant must supply the information required by Subsection H of Section 42 and a public notice of the variance must be posted on the property two weeks prior to approval (Amy Moore will post the notice). Commissioners elected officers for 2018: Phil Snyder as Chair, Matt Reno as Vice Chair, and Loretta Hohmann as Secretary. The Town update noted the Town decided not to purchase the Wooters property, letters were issued for parking and trash violations with cleanup deadlines or fines, the Sheriff's Department increased patrols on Rt. 18 and Del Rhodes Avenue, and the Town Manager is exploring costs for electronic speed indicators. Discussion of current sign regulations was deferred until the Town Planner can advise; members were asked to review the ordinance and bring suggestions to the March meeting. Minutes for Nov. 1, 2017 and Jan. 3, 2018 were approved and the meeting adjourned at 8:20 p.m.
